Officials Push For Nashville Immigration Judge
posted July 16, 2008

Sens. Lamar Alexander and Bob Corker along with Reps. Jim Cooper and Marsha Blackburn today joined Davidson County Sheriff Daron Hall in urging federal officials from the Department of Justice and Department of Homeland Security to install an immigration judge in Nashville to speed up the process and reduce the cost of removing illegal immigrants, such as the approximately 700 processed since April 2007 who were arrested for at least one serious crime such as homicide, robbery, aggravated assault or burglary.
